Dad hired a guy in the neighborhood to plow his pasture for the first time in about 1953 or so- he had a huge Moline (to a 5 year old)- a G or some variant, I think. Had a homemade cab big enough to live in, and pulled a 4 bottom plow- pretty impressive stuff. The guy's name was Hobert Tanner (I found out years later), but everyone called him Fatty. Weighed well over 300, and his appetite was the stuff of legends. Mom made a huge lunch, and I remember him systematically going through a whole bowl of boiled potatoes. Saw the tractor probably 40 years later in the local scrap yard- there was no forgetting that cab!
